What is the formula to calculate the area of a rectangle?

Back

The area of a rectangle is calculated using the formula: Area = length × width.

What is the area of a triangle?

Back

The area of a triangle is calculated using the formula: Area = (base × height) / 2.

What is the unit of area?

Back

The unit of area is typically square units, such as square inches (in²), square feet (ft²), or square centimeters (cm²).

How do you find the area of a square?

Back

The area of a square is calculated using the formula: Area = side × side or Area = side².

What is the perimeter of a shape?

Back

The perimeter is the total distance around the outside of a shape.

How do you calculate the perimeter of a rectangle?

Back

The perimeter of a rectangle is calculated using the formula: Perimeter = 2 × (length + width).

What is the area of a circle?

Back

The area of a circle is calculated using the formula: Area = π × radius².
